Factoid Extra: Just like the Super Minx (that originally was supposed to replace it), the Minx in Series V form saw a roof & rear window redesign to ‘modernise’ it replacing the dated reverse-rake rear window…

Factoid Extra: By the time the MkIII Sprite appeared in 1964 it was sharing a body with the MG Midget (which was technically the badge-engineered version) & now featured wind-up windows & external door handles & locks…
